The chemical composition of iron ores has an apparent wide range in chemical composition especially for Fe content and associated gangue minerals. Major iron minerals associated with most of the iron ores are hematite, goethite, limonite and magnetite. The main contaminants in iron ores are SiO2 and Al2O3. 2. IRON ORES AND CONCENTRATION METHODS Iron ores are partly separated to seven groups according to their properties and chemical compositions. These are magnetite ores, hematite ores, magnetite + hematite ores, siderite ores, limonite ores, titanomagnetite ores, and silicatic ores. · Iron ore is composed of one or more iron-containing minerals and gangues, which are also entrained with some impurities. The gangue is also composed of one or several minerals (compounds). Iron-bearing minerals and gangues are called minerals and are compounds with a certain chemical composition and crystal structure. Types and characteristics

Hematite is the alteration product of many Fe-bearing minerals, especially, magnetite, siderite, and pyrite, and is precipitated in seas and lakes by chemical or organic processes. Its occurrence may be attributed, but not limited, to intense weathering under normal and oxidizing environments. Sedimentary deposits of hematite may be extensive and constitute major ores of iron. …

Hematite is a mineral the chemical composition of which rarely differs significantly from stoichiometric Fe 2 O 3. As such, little attention has been paid to the mineral chemistry of hematite in Precambrian iron formations, where hematite forms monomineralic high-grade orebodies. What is the chemical composition of hematite? Pure hematite has a composition of about 70% iron and 30% oxygen by weight. Like most natural materials, it is rarely found with that pure composition. This is particularly true of the sedimentary deposits where hematite forms by inorganic or biological precipitation in a body of water.

· general, the blending of ores at mines site is controlled by the chemical composition of the ores by controlling the Al 2O 3 and SiO 2 levels on the lowest side possible. However, if there is a change in mineralogy, like an increase in hydrous phase the composition may still be the same, but this dif-ference may affect the sinterability and sinter quality. The …
